Miley Cyrus Stuns VMA Audience

The 2013 MTV Video Music Awards performance that had everyone talking – and gasping – was Miley Cyrus’ racy rendition of “We Can’t Stop.”

The 20-year-old twerked her way into VMA history while performing her hit single with giant dancing teddy bears and a revealing nude-colored bikini, and later, gyrating against Robin Thicke as he performed “Blurred Lines,” as part of a multi-song medley.

Before Miley and Robin’s performance, Access Hollywood guest correspondent Coco Jones caught up with Robin on the red carpet, where he hinted that his headline-making pairing with the former Disney star was going to make heads turn.

“I will tell you that Miley Cyrus is no longer Hannah Montana. That I will say,” the singer said.
